Bourn back on track

The Phillies returned home from their western swing and dropped a 5-1 decision to the Cubs.   Carlos Ruiz (.298) and Freddy Galvis (.206) had one hit each, while Antonio Bastardo (.2 IP, 1 walk, 1 hit) and Mike Schwimer (1.1 IP, 2runs, 2 hits, 1 walk) each worked behind Roy Halladay, who took the loss.

In Cincinnati, the Astros topped the Reds, 6-4.  Alfredo Simon (2.79) tossed 1.1 scoreless innings in relief, giving up 2 hits and a walk, for the Reds........In Atlanta, the Braves defeated the Pirates, 6-1, Michael Bourn (.317) had 2 hits and started another hitting streak for Atlanta..........In St. Paul, the Twins lost a 7-6 game to the Royals.  Matt Maloney recorded an out, and stranded 2 inherited runners.
